On Jun 5, 2010, at 10:12 AM, Mark Roberts wrote:
> But once some smaller independent theaters stepped up to go forward
> with screenings, nobody ever made good on the original threats. When
> the screenings happened, there were police outside the building and
> security inside the theater, stationed up by the screen to watch the
> audience. As far as I heard, there was never any trouble.
And that's the point: it's usually the independent theaters who have
few corporate ties that can make these stands. So far, all the
theaters that have dropped out with The Cove have more complex
ownerships, I believe. Personally, I still bet The Cove will be shown,
and it will be shown at small places like Dainana Geijutsu Gekijo in
Osaka that was one of the first to stick with Yasukuni (I of course
don't know if they have signed up to show it).
